Attribute für mit ASP.NET erstellte XML-Webdienste und XML-Webdienstclients

Dieses Thema bezieht sich auf eine veraltete Technologie. XML-Webdienste und XML-Webdienstclients sollten nun mithilfe der folgenden Technologie erstellt werden: Windows Communication Foundation.

In der folgenden Tabelle sind die Attribute aufgeführt, die auf einen mit ASP.NET erstellten Webdienst oder einen Webdienstclient angewendet werden können.

Attribut Beschreibung

WebMethod

Durch die Anwendung dieser Attribute auf eine Methode wird diese zu einer Webdienstmethode.

WebService

Durch die Anwendung dieses Attributs auf eine Klasse, die einen Webdienst implementiert, lassen sich zusätzliche Informationen zum Webdienst angeben, beispielsweise der Standard-XML-Namespace.

WebServiceBinding

Durch die Anwendung dieses Attributs auf eine Klasse, die einen Webdienst oder eine Proxyklasse implementiert, werden die durch diesen Webdienst implementierten Bindungen angegeben.

SoapDocumentMethod

Durch die Anwendung dieses Attributs auf eine Webdienstmethode oder eine Methode einer Proxyklasse wird angegeben, dass dokumentenbasierte SOAP-Nachrichten erwartet werden.

SoapDocumentService

Durch die Anwendung dieses Attributs auf eine Klasse, die einen Webdienst oder eine Proxyklasse implementiert, wird angegeben, dass die in der Klasse enthaltenen Methoden standardmäßig dokumentenbasierte SOAP-Nachrichten erwarten.

SoapRpcMethod

Durch die Anwendung dieses Attributs auf eine Webdienstmethode oder eine Methode einer Proxyklasse wird angegeben, dass RPC-basierte SOAP-Nachrichten erwartet werden.

SoapRpcService

Durch die Anwendung dieses Attributs auf eine Klasse, die einen Webdienst oder eine Proxyklasse implementiert, wird angegeben, dass die in der Klasse enthaltenen Methoden standardmäßig RPC-basierte SOAP-Nachrichten erwarten.

SoapHeader

Durch die Anwendung dieses Attributs auf eine Webdienstmethode oder eine Methode einer Proxyklasse wird angegeben, dass diese einen bestimmten SOAP-Header verarbeiten kann.

SoapExtension

Durch die Anwendung eines von dieser Klasse abgeleiteten Attributs auf eine Webdienstmethode oder eine Methode einer Proxyklasse wird angegeben, dass in der Webdienstmethode eine SOAP-Erweiterung ausgeführt werden soll.

MatchAttribute

Stellt die Attribute eines Vergleichs dar, der anhand von Textmustern durchgeführt wurde. Nur für Webdienstclients gültig.

Siehe auch

Verweis

WebService